Rachel Gilbreath

Technical Assistant; Chemistry DivisionChicago, IL

Manhattan Project VeteranProject Worker/Staff

Rachel Gilbreath was a laboratory technician at the University of Chicago’s Metallurgical Laboratory (“Met Lab”) during the Manhattan Project.

Gilbreath began working at the Met Lab in the Health Physics Group. In April 1946, she was transferred to the Solvent-Extraction Group in the Chemistry Division.
